As a Senior Research Fellow in Launch and Space Propulsion Technology, you will play a key role in strengthening Kingston University’s research translation and knowledge exchange (KE) activity, building on the University’s unique contribution to the UK National Space Strategy. You will bring a substantial research and KE track record in space propulsion technology, including attracting external income and making a significant contribution to the space propulsion technology research and KE field through your activities. This role will focus on translating applied and academic space propulsion technology research into industry‑ready, policy‑relevant, and societally impactful outcomes.
Working with academic colleagues, industry partners, public sector organisations, and SMEs, you will:
- Accelerate space propulsion technology research translation and adoption
- Develop and deliver new external partnerships and income‑generating activity
- Enhance Kingston University’s national profile as a leading contributor to the UK National Space Strategy specifically with a focus on supporting sovereign launch capabilities
You will be accountable for delivering measurable research and KE translation outcomes, including securing external funding, generating high‑impact outputs, and building strategic partnerships.

Environment and Team
This role sits within Academic Services, part of Kingston University’s Knowledge Exchange and Research Institutes (KERIs), which drive the University’s mission to translate research into real‑world impact. The Cyber, Engineering and Digital Technologies KERI brings together over 60 academics alongside industry partners, policymakers, and communities to tackle strategic innovation challenges and deliver meaningful economic, social, and environmental impact. Building on Kingston’s leading contribution to the UK National Space Strategy, the team is at the forefront of launch and space propulsion innovation – driving national priorities in skills, research impact, and economic growth, supported by cutting‑edge facilities and strategic partnerships across the UK space sector. You will join a highly collaborative and interdisciplinary environment that delivers research excellence and drives societal impact at scale.
